Output 14688aa91adfe3b3820610ee0805443cf9f02b43641af669837567c31b9d2f85:1

value
25952908
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d57228549b31b41928c76c274baf92b551796081 OP_EQUAL
address
3M9ccD46qng6CatxSgJM72jfK4ZAbX8ciJ
transaction
14688aa91adfe3b3820610ee0805443cf9f02b43641af669837567c31b9d2f85
spent
true